Jak mogę się dowiedzieć, jaki PID używam w systemie Linux?

Najłatwiejszym sposobem sprawdzenia, czy proces jest uruchomiony, jest uruchomienie polecenia ps aux i nazwy procesu grep. Jeśli otrzymałeś dane wyjściowe wraz z nazwą/pidem procesu, twój proces jest uruchomiony.

Jak znaleźć PID uruchomionego procesu w systemie Linux?

Możesz znaleźć PID procesów uruchomionych w systemie za pomocą poniższej dziewiątej komendy.

  1. pidof: pidof – znajdź identyfikator procesu uruchomionego programu.
  2. pgrep: pgre – wyszukiwanie lub sygnalizowanie procesów na podstawie nazwy i innych atrybutów.
  3. ps: ps – zgłoś migawkę bieżących procesów.
  4. pstree: pstree – wyświetla drzewo procesów.

Jak mogę się dowiedzieć, co robi PID?

Świetnym narzędziem do wykorzystania jest ps i lsof. Możesz użyć ps, aby znaleźć PID lub identyfikator procesu tego procesu, lub użyć ps -u {nazwa-użytkownika procesu}, aby uzyskać jego PID. Następnie użyj lsof, aby zobaczyć, które pliki zostały otwarte przez ten PID, tak jak lsof -p pid . Możesz również użyć netstat, aby wyświetlić wszystkie połączenia i odpowiadające im porty.

Jak mogę zobaczyć wszystkie uruchomione procesy w systemie Linux?

Sprawdź działający proces w systemie Linux

  1. Otwórz okno terminala w systemie Linux.
  2. W przypadku zdalnego serwera Linux użyj polecenia ssh do logowania.
  3. Wpisz ps aux polecenie, aby zobaczyć wszystkie uruchomione procesy w systemie Linux.
  4. Alternatywnie możesz wydać polecenie top lub htop, aby wyświetlić uruchomiony proces w systemie Linux.

24 lutego. 2021 r.

Jak zabić PID w Uniksie?

przykłady polecenia kill, aby zabić proces w systemie Linux

  1. Krok 1 – Znajdź PID (identyfikator procesu) lighttpd. Użyj polecenia ps lub pidof, aby znaleźć PID dla dowolnego programu. …
  2. Krok 2 – zabij proces za pomocą PID. PID # 3486 jest przypisany do procesu lighttpd. …
  3. Krok 3 – Jak sprawdzić, czy proces został zakończony/zabity.

24 lutego. 2021 r.

Jak znaleźć nazwę procesu za pomocą PID?

Aby uzyskać wiersz polecenia dla identyfikatora procesu 9999, przeczytaj plik /proc/9999/cmdline . W Linuksie możesz zajrzeć do /proc/ . Spróbuj wpisać man proc, aby uzyskać więcej informacji. Zawartość /proc/$PID/cmdline da ci wiersz poleceń, z którym został uruchomiony proces $PID.

Jak zabić PID?

Aby zabić proces, użyj polecenia kill. Użyj polecenia ps, jeśli chcesz znaleźć PID procesu. Zawsze staraj się zabić proces za pomocą prostego polecenia kill. Jest to najczystszy sposób na zabicie procesu i ma taki sam efekt jak anulowanie procesu.

Co to jest PID w górnym poleceniu?

top polecenie służy do pokazania procesów Linuksa. Zapewnia dynamiczny podgląd działającego systemu w czasie rzeczywistym. … PID: Pokazuje unikalny identyfikator procesu zadania. PR: oznacza priorytet zadania. SHR: reprezentuje ilość pamięci współdzielonej używanej przez zadanie.

Jak znaleźć PID w systemie Windows?

Krok 1: Naciśnij jednocześnie Ctrl + Shift + Esc, aby otworzyć okno Menedżera zadań. Krok 2: Jeśli okno wyświetla się w uproszczonym trybie podsumowania, kliknij Więcej szczegółów w lewym dolnym rogu. Krok 3: W oknie Menedżera zadań kliknij kartę Szczegóły. Następnie na ekranie pojawia się PID.

Jak znaleźć identyfikator procesu w systemie Unix?

Linux / UNIX: Dowiedz się lub ustal, czy działa pid procesu

  1. Zadanie: Znajdź pid procesu. Po prostu użyj polecenia ps w następujący sposób: …
  2. Znajdź identyfikator procesu uruchomionego programu za pomocą pidof. komenda pidof wyszukuje identyfikatory procesów (pid) wymienionych programów. …
  3. Znajdź PID za pomocą polecenia pgrep.

27 czerwca. 2015 г.

Czym jest Kill 9 w Linuksie?

kill -9 Polecenie Linuksa

Polecenie kill -9 wysyła sygnał SIGKILL wskazujący usłudze natychmiastowe zamknięcie. Program, który nie odpowiada, zignoruje polecenie kill, ale zostanie zamknięty za każdym razem, gdy wydane zostanie polecenie kill -9. Używaj tego polecenia ostrożnie.

Jak zabić pracę w Uniksie?

Oto co robimy:

  1. Użyj polecenia ps, aby uzyskać identyfikator procesu (PID) procesu, który chcemy zakończyć.
  2. Wydaj polecenie kill dla tego PID.
  3. Jeśli proces odmawia zakończenia (tj. ignoruje sygnał), wysyłaj coraz ostrzejsze sygnały, aż się zakończy.

Jaka jest różnica między poleceniem kill a poleceniem Pkill?

Główna różnica między tymi narzędziami polega na tym, że kill kończy procesy na podstawie numeru identyfikacyjnego procesu (PID), podczas gdy polecenia killall i pkill kończą uruchomione procesy na podstawie ich nazw i innych atrybutów.

Polub ten post? Podziel się z przyjaciółmi:
System operacyjny dzisiaj